NCDOT Awards Contract to Improve Mecklenburg County Roads 

Staff Report//April 9, 2026//

Nine miles of roadways in Mecklenburg County are set to be resurfaced, thanks to a $3.7 million contract the N.C. Department of Transportation awarded last month to South Carolina contractor King Asphalt Inc. 

One primary road included in this contract is a stretch of U.S. 521 from the South Carolina border to Brixham Hill Road. Both directions will be milled, patched and resurfaced with new pavement markings and pavement markers.

The remainder of the contract includes more than a dozen secondary roads in the south end of the county:

  • Blue Granite Road             
  • Slate Court 
  • Woodside Falls Road 
  • Limestone Lane 
  • Sapphire Lane 
  • Emerald Court 
  • Diamond Drive 
  • Peridot Court 
  • Cotton Lane 
  • Sawtry Court 
  • Gatestone Lane 
  • Dansville Drive 
  • Wildiris Court 
  • Seastone Lane 
  • Baker Mills Road

Contract crews can begin the project as early as this month and will have until the fall of 2027 to complete the project. 

Lane closures on U.S. 521 will be restricted to overnight hours from 9 p.m. to 5 a.m. Mondays – Sundays, and special provisions will be in place for holidays and special events that generate significant traffic volumes.
